AIDS protesters demand G-20 fund disease treatment

"PITTSBURGH (AP) - About 100 AIDS activists dressed in black are marching behind coffins in Pittsburgh, demanding the world's most powerful leaders help thousands worldwide who will die of the disease.

"Protesters say the Group of 20 is using the global financial crisis as an excuse to cut promised funding.

"They say some African nations are already running out of key drugs, and some clinics are taking people off HIV treatment."
